Texas Roadhouse has signaled an ambitious growth trajectory for 2026, planning to open dozens of new restaurant locations across the United States. According to Inc., the steakhouse operator remains committed to expanding its footprint despite ongoing challenges in the casual dining sector. This expansion represents a significant capital commitment and underscores the chain's confidence in consumer demand for its core steakhouse concept.
